Drone installations in Extremadura

The town of Zafra in Badajoz province is about to undergo a significant transformation in its industrial sector with the launch of a high-tech project. The company ARMMO Defense Technologies This municipality has been selected to build what it aspires to be the most important factory for autonomous systems and drones in Europe, a move that places the region in a privileged position within the security and defense sector.

This business venture arises in a context where strategic autonomy has become an absolute priority for EU institutions. The project, led by specialists with extensive international experience, seeks not only to manufacture devices, but also to establish a environment of constant innovation that allows us to respond quickly to current technological challenges, combining hardware production with advanced software development.

A comprehensive industrial hub in Extremadura

Drone production in Spain

The planned infrastructure in Zafra will not be limited to unit assembly, but will house complete capabilities ranging from the treatment of composite materials to the integration of electronic sensorsThe intention is that all phases of creation of an unmanned platform occur in the same facility, which facilitates much closer coordination between the engineering and mass production teams.

The town's mayor, Juan Carlos Fernández, has expressed his satisfaction with the arrival of an industry that requires highly qualified personnel, which represents a boost for the local economy. The factory, whose construction is in a very advanced stage, is expected to... opening soon, becoming an engine of specialized employment that will attract both national professionals and experts from other international markets.

Strategic leadership and European vision

European autonomous technology

Leading this initiative is Jaime Abrisqueta, a businessman with over a decade of experience in industrial cooperation programs and defense standards in Brussels. His vision centers on the idea that the defense of the future depends not only on economic investment, but also on... ability to integrate technology at the same speed as the needs of the environment evolve, preventing systems from becoming obsolete in a few months.

The company has designed solutions encompassing aerial, land, and naval platforms, such as its CAT-A platform, designed for aquatic environments. This multidisciplinary approach allows the company to be seen not only as a drone manufacturer, but as a versatile industrial platform capable of offering comprehensive answers through systems that can operate in a coordinated manner in different operational scenarios.

Validation in international settings

Spanish high-tech drones

The project's significance has already resonated in institutional and operational circles, with recent participation in tactical experimentation exercises alongside the Army. These tests, overseen by the Head of State, served to demonstrate the effectiveness of its capabilities. detection and interception systems, consolidating confidence in Spanish engineering as a key element for strengthening deterrence capabilities in the national territory.

Looking ahead, the firm's agenda includes participation in NATO exercises in Slovakia and at world-renowned trade fairs such as Eurosatory. These events are crucial for establish strategic alliances with other industrial partners and showcase the potential of the developments made from Extremadura to defense agencies of various countries, thus reinforcing its vocation for global leadership.

Technological sovereignty and talent acquisition

Drone research center

One of ARMMO's fundamental pillars is building an ecosystem that doesn't depend on external technologies, thus guaranteeing total operational independence. To achieve this, they are incorporating profiles from the industry's most cutting-edge programs, blending the experience of veterans with the emerging talent of engineers local, which ensures a constant transfer of knowledge at the Zafra plant.

Advanced manufacturing of autonomous systems

The consolidation of this technology center in Badajoz represents a firm step towards a more modern and efficient defense industry. With an infrastructure capable of managing everything from initial design to field testing and technical training, the initiative not only benefits continental security but also projects an image of industrial strength and competitiveness which places Spain at the forefront of the development of autonomous systems for the coming decades.
